A long-time landmark in Kitchener, formerly known as The Laurentian, this 11-storey, 122-unit community was built in 1964 and features exceptionally large 1, 2, and 3-bedroom suites in both original and modern finishes. Residents appreciate the building's solid construction, spacious layouts, and the blend of mid-century character with updated conveniences. Well-maintained by dedicated on-site superintendents, the property offers a welcoming front foyer, a party room, fitness room, underground parking garage, and a seasonal outdoor pool. With its quiet residential setting and oversized suites, the building is an excellent fit for empty nesters looking to downsize and couples seeking more living space without sacrificing comfort or amenities. Take a walk along Queen Street in Kitchener, Ontario and you’ll understand why this fast-growing city is so attractive. With its quaint cafés, small boutiques, and unique art galleries, downtown’s Queen Street is a favourite destination of residents and visitors alike. But that isn’t the only reason you’ll love renting in Kitchener.
The city, located about 100 km west of Toronto and bordered by the Grand River, contains several terrific parks, including McLennan Park, a favourite destination that provides a playground, a dog park, hiking trails, and a skate park. The Huron Natural Area is another great hiking destination with trails traversing more than 250 acres of protected forest and wetland.
For something a little more landscaped, check out the classic Victorian gardens at Rockway Gardens, home of the summer concert series.
